### Changelog — Firmware Channel Key Rotation (v4.7)

Rotated the signing key for the Ottercrest firmware update channel. The old key had been in service since the beta days and predates our HSM setup, so it's now revoked across all device cohorts. Devices on agent 2.3+ pick up the new trust root automatically; older agents need the bridge patch first. For reviewer reference, the newly active channel key is the following.

release key, kawif-hawep: bky13_X7TGuRG4Zu4ZJ

Leadership Review Briefing — Insurance Renewal

Our general liability and cargo policies with Pellbrook Mutual renew at month-end. Premiums rise 11%, driven mainly by last year's Harwick depot claim. Coverage limits stay unchanged; the deductible on fleet incidents doubles. Sales leads should note the revised certificate process for large accounts, as some clients require updated proof of cover. Further planning detail follows directly below.

board note of tadup-tajog: Headcount on the Oliiel team goes from 31 to 88 by the end of February. Gross margin on Oliiel came in at 62 percent against a plan of 29 percent.

**Ticket ORM-914: Legacy Mapletide ORM refactor breaks soft deletes**

Hey, quick one before the cut: after the Mapletide ORM refactor, soft-deleted rows reappear in list views. Repro: delete any invoice, reload the dashboard, it's back. Old mapper ignored the deleted_at flag rewrite. Blocking release. To poke at the staging API yourself, use the bearer token below.

session JWT of yawep-yawep = eyJhbGciOiJIUzI1NiIsInR5cCI6IkpXVCJ9.eyJzdWIiOiI3pWF3_In0.aXYsHiog